- Hong UnderwoodMay 18, 2025 · a month agoFrictional unemployment refers to the temporary unemployment that occurs when people are transitioning between jobs. In the context of cryptocurrency, this can be a concern for investors because it may lead to a decrease in market liquidity. When individuals are unemployed, they may have less disposable income to invest in cryptocurrencies, which can result in lower trading volumes and potentially affect the overall market sentiment. Additionally, frictional unemployment can also impact the adoption and development of blockchain technology, as unemployed individuals may have less resources and time to contribute to the industry.
